Step-by-Step: Building Your First Itaobuy Spreadsheet
Step 1: Choose Your Platform
Google Sheets is the most popular choice for beginners because it is free, works on any device, and syncs automatically. Microsoft Excel and Notion are also solid alternatives if you prefer offline access or database-style layouts.
Step 2: Set Up Your Columns
Create a new spreadsheet and add these columns in row one: Date Added, Product Name, Category, Product Link, Price, Size, Color, Seller Name, Seller Rating, Status (Want / Bought / Skipped), and Notes. These eleven columns cover everything a beginner needs.
Step 3: Add Conditional Formatting
Make your spreadsheet visual by color-coding the Status column. Green for Bought, yellow for Want, and gray for Skipped. This simple visual cue lets you scan your list in seconds.
Step 4: Use Data Validation for Consistency
To avoid typos and inconsistent entries, use dropdown menus for columns like Category, Size, and Status. In Google Sheets, select a column, go to Data > Data Validation, and enter your allowed values.
Step 5: Save and Share
Save your sheet with a clear name like "My Itaobuy Spreadsheet 2026." If you shop with friends or run a small reselling group, share the sheet with edit or view-only permissions depending on your needs.

Pro Tips for Beginners
- Start small — Do not try to track fifty products on day one. Begin with five to ten items and expand as you get comfortable.
- Update weekly — Set a 15-minute reminder every weekend to check prices and update statuses.
- Use the Notes field — Jot down why you skipped an item or what size you need. This prevents repeated research.
- Link to source — Always paste the exact product URL so you can return instantly without searching again.
